futurebuilder flutter listview

The flutter code below is pretty straightforward and is easy to understand. This code is bootstrapped by a main function in the same file. The ListView widget code is in JobsListView.dart. To use it in main.dart, you need to import it. After that, you can now create an instance of the JobsListView widget. It displays its children one after another in the scroll direction i.e, vertical or horizontal. In this tutorial, we’re gonna build a Flutter App that shows a ListView. Difficulty Level : Hard. I am making Android Studio as my IDE to build Flutter Application . Flutter - Future and FutureBuilder . Flutter - Navigation . You can use set futureBanjir again and call setState. We are using PHP scripting language to make server API which converts all the database data into JSON format which we would parse into our flutter ListView. We will try to create a simple application using Flutter that is integrated with the SQLite database. We have ‘index’ which acts as a key for reorderable list view … Created Mar 3, 2018. 14 Flutter: Friendly Chat App. Here is the final main.dart code. To implement an infinitiveScroll, wouldn't using a futureBuilder be a good option? listview inside column flutter not scrolling. 08 Flutter: Tab Navigation. OPEN. It shows the list using ListView.builder, sends/gets data to/from NoteScreen using Navigator. import dart:convert first. In Flutter, the FutureBuilder Widget is used to create widgets based on the latest snapshot of interaction with a Future. - main.dart . It serves as a bridge between the Future and the widget’s UI. flutter futurebuilder future to list example. We are using PHP scripting language to make server API which converts all the database data into JSON format which we would parse into our flutter ListView. Listview.builder in Flutter. hide. Basically if you want to make ListView Dynamic you can use ListView Builder it will create dynamic ListTiles based on your definition. Then execute this command: flutter pub get. You are using FutureBuilder wrong, check the documentation: The future must have been obtained earlier, e.g. Official In our case, we wrap our ListView widget with a FutureBuilder where we tie this FutureBuilder onto the Future> result given out by the getPosts () method. I have a button that does a context.read to add a new item, but when I click it the ListView doesn't change. So this is a solution to that. Pop to the previous screen. When I add an item to the ListView, it duplicate the list and then added the item to that list. We wrapped the ListView.builder in RefreshIndicator to implement the pull to refresh mechanism. 15 Flutter: Changing icon color onfocus. FutureBuilder widget is used to get current state of future objects. So we can display something particular for that state. Asynchronous functions are used to handle operations which take time to perform and return result after some time. Flutter FutureBuilder widget calls future function to wait some time for result. FutureBuilder widget is stateful widget by default. I am creating JSON by myself using MySQL data and to convert MySQL data i am using PHP scripting language. branflake2267 / main.dart. You give it a Future and builder method, and it will automatically rebuild its children when the Future completes. Flutter: How to Save Objects in SharedPreferences. Posted by 5 days ago. Understanding Center Widget in Flutter. – NoteScreen (note_screen.dart) is the user interface for adding/updating Note. Skip to content. In this article, I'm going to share an example of how to implement RefreshIndicator widget with a ListView which is populated from JSON. This article shows you how to use the FutureBuilder widget in Flutter with a complete example. Read more. hide. Control Flow. ※ I omitted some steps like Firebase.initializeApp() etc. Named Parameter. Creating Flutter Application to Display Image in ListView Builder | Flutter Deno Example. ... Flutter—FutureBuilder. Flutter - Future and FutureBuilder . Is android studio still the "go to" tool even if I want to use flutter for IOS and web as well and Android, or is there something that's a little bit less resource hungry that I can pair with ADB for the installation? Dart provides us some great ways for handling asynchronous operations which is what Futures is all about, and Flutter provides us with great widgets, such as the FutureBuilder which is what I am going to use in this example. build a widget based of list data from a future. – ListViewNote (listview_note.dart) is a StatefulWidget with List is state variable. Yogita Kumar in The Startup. 🗒 Listing TO-DOs (“R” in CRUD) Now that Flutter Data is ready to use, we have access to our Repository via Provider’s context.watch. We complete our introduction of Flutter by returning to the simple LWN RSS feed headline viewer that was introduced in part one. Say you have a network service that’s going to return some JSON, and you want to display it. 8 comments. Flutter supports JSON data exchange using HTTP libraries. constructor. Before that, you can read other articles with a database connection to Flutter. Exception Handling. Implementing infinite scrolling listview (lazy loading/pagination) using ListView.builder on flutter app. In this tutorial we would Create JSON Parsing ListView in Flutter Android iOS App Example Tutorial. We will be adding several new features to that application in part two, including interactive elements to demonstrate some of the UI features of Flutter. If you like our tutorials, please check out our blog. report. 13 Flutter: JSON Storage. The Flutter FutureBuilder is a great example of Flutters composability with widgets. Another way to retrieve data, is … In the above example, I have assigned the array of projects to the list, you can call API.for example Implement the widget to display the list of projects with the future builder. In my example, the future function ` getProjectDetails ()` is called in the future. As soon as the result appears, it calls the builder. Evan Fang in The Startup. In this tutorial, we’re gonna build a Flutter App that shows a ListView. Flutter Advance. So, Lets understand what is ListView Builder and what it takes to implement in App. It shows the list using ListView.builder, sends/gets data to/from NoteScreen using Navigator. Step 3: Creating JSON file under assets directory. For example, in places like FutureBuilder, StreamBuilder, AnimatedBuilder, the build method, the ListView builder, and more. Step 1: Create a new Flutter Project. What is FutureBuilder Widget in Flutter? We would Add Item click onPress event on ListView and on onPress event get the selected item ID and send the ID to next activity. 100% Upvoted. I’m new in flutter, I’d like to know how to add an item list dynamically to ListView without reloading data in FutureBuilder. save. flutter get data from future without async await list listview. Let’s follow the steps below to implement ListView using a JSON file: // This widget is the root of your application. In Flutter, ListView is a scrollable list of widgets arranged linearly. ListView Class in Flutter. The ListView also supports removing item from the list. Dart. Flutter provides ListView.Builder () constructor, which can be used to generate dynamic content from external sources. What this means is that any change in device configuration or widget rebuilds would trigger your Future to fire multiple times. Embed. Copy link chankongching commented Jun 27, 2019. shld it be snapshot.data.length - index - 1 ?? There is a list of notes with title and note body each. Variables. flutter futurebuilder future to list example. File > New > New Flutter Project . future builder example in flutter. return object of future builder. May 26, 2020. Demo. It is necessary for Future to be obtained earlier either through a change of state or change in dependencies. Go to the other screen and add a new item.

Dollar General Promotions, Gartner Magic Quadrant Identity Governance And Administration 2020, Alan Partridge Fernando, Internship Paragon 2021, Auckland Aces Vs Canterbury Kings Toss, West Jefferson Hospital Covid Vaccine, Wedding Industry Conferences 2021, Woodlands Entertainment, What Will Happen On Judgement Day 2021, Dewalt Compressor Won T Shut Off, Giant Slalom Olympics, Pes 2020 Controller Settings Pc,

Leave a Reply

Your email address will not be published. Required fields are marked *